缩略图

WordPress 教程:实战技巧与最佳实践总结

2026年06月22日 文章分类 会被自动插入 会被自动插入
本文最后更新于2026-06-22已经过去了0天请注意内容时效性
热度2 点赞 收藏0 评论0

在搭建网站的过程中,WordPress 凭借其强大的生态系统和易用性,成为了全球最受欢迎的内容管理系统之一。然而,很多新手在接触这个平台时,往往只停留在基础的安装与主题更换上,忽略了那些能显著提升性能、安全性与开发效率的实战技巧。本文将深入探讨一系列经过验证的最佳实践,帮助你从“会用”进阶到“精通”。无论你是刚接触这个领域的初学者,还是希望优化现有项目的开发者,这篇 WordPress 教程 都能为你提供可直接落地的解决方案。

性能优化:从加载速度到用户体验

网站的加载速度不仅影响用户体验,更是搜索引擎排名的重要指标。许多 WordPress 站点性能不佳,往往是因为忽略了几个关键配置。首先,缓存机制是提升速度的第一道防线。你可以通过插件(如 WP Rocket 或 W3 Total Cache)启用页面静态化缓存,将动态生成的 HTML 文件存储起来,避免每次访问都执行 PHP 查询。 其次,图片优化是另一个常见痛点。未经压缩的图片会显著拖慢页面加载。建议在上传图片前,使用工具(如 TinyPNG)进行压缩,并在 WordPress 中设置合适的缩略图尺寸。在主题的 functions.php 文件中,可以添加以下代码来禁用不必要的图片尺寸生成,减少服务器负担:

// 移除默认的图片尺寸,只保留必要的
add_filter('intermediate_image_sizes', function($sizes) {
    return array_diff($sizes, ['1536x1536', '2048x2048']);
});

最后,数据库优化不容忽视。随着文章、修订版本和垃圾评论的积累,数据库会变得臃肿。定期使用插件(如 WP-Optimize)清理修订版本、删除未使用的标签和草稿,可以有效减小数据库体积,提升查询效率。记住,一个轻量级的数据库是高性能 WordPress 站点的基础。

安全加固:防止常见攻击与漏洞

WordPress 的安全性一直是社区关注的重点。由于开源特性,它容易成为暴力破解和恶意攻击的目标。本段 WordPress 教程 将分享几个核心的安全实践。首先,强化登录入口是第一步。避免使用默认的“admin”用户名,并设置复杂的密码。更高级的做法是启用双因素认证(2FA),通过插件如 Wordfence 或 iThemes Security 可以轻松实现。 其次,文件权限与目录保护至关重要。确保服务器上的 wp-config.php 文件权限设置为 400 或 440,防止他人通过浏览器直接读取数据库配置。同时,在 .htaccess 文件中添加以下规则,可以阻止对 wp-includeswp-content/uploads 目录的直接 PHP 执行:

<Directory "wp-content/uploads">
    php_flag engine off
</Directory>
<Files wp-config.php>
    order allow,deny
    deny from all
</Files>

最后,保持更新是最简单但最有效的安全策略。始终确保 WordPress 核心、主题和插件都更新到最新版本。许多安全漏洞都是因为用户忽略了版本更新提示而被利用。建议开启自动更新,或者设置定期手动检查的提醒,将风险降到最低。

开发效率:自定义功能与模板技巧

对于需要定制功能的开发者来说,理解 WordPress 的钩子(Hooks)机制是提升效率的关键。不要直接修改父主题的文件,而是创建一个子主题,并在其 functions.php 中使用 add_actionadd_filter 来扩展功能。例如,如果你想在文章内容后自动添加一个版权声明,可以这样写:

// 在文章内容后追加版权信息
add_filter('the_content', 'add_copyright_notice');
function add_copyright_notice($content) {
    if (is_single()) {
        $notice = '<p class="copyright">© 2024 你的网站名称。保留所有权利。</p>';
        $content .= $notice;
    }
    return $content;
}

另一个提高开发效率的技巧是使用本地开发环境。工具如 Local by Flywheel 或 Docker 可以让你在本地快速搭建 WordPress 实例,避免在线上直接调试导致网站崩溃。本地开发还能让你自由测试插件和主题,而不用担心影响线上用户。 此外,合理使用自定义文章类型(Custom Post Types) 可以让你摆脱“文章”和“页面”的束缚。例如,你可以为“作品集”或“产品”创建独立的文章类型,配合自定义字段(ACF 插件)实现更灵活的数据管理。这不仅能保持后台整洁,还能让前端模板的调用更加清晰。

内容策略与SEO:让网站被更多人看到

一个技术优秀的 WordPress 站点,如果缺乏有效的内容策略,也难以获得理想的流量。SEO 优化不仅仅是安装一个 Yoast 插件那么简单。首先,URL 结构要简洁且包含关键词。在设置中,建议将固定链接设置为“文章名”,避免出现日期和数字 ID。例如:https://example.com/wordpress-tutorialhttps://example.com/?p=123 更友好。 其次,内部链接与面包屑导航能提升搜索引擎的爬取效率。确保每篇文章都链接到站内其他相关页面,并使用面包屑插件(如 Breadcrumb NavXT)来构建清晰的层级结构。在主题的 single.php 中添加面包屑代码,可以增强用户体验:

<?php
if (function_exists('bcn_display')) {
    echo '<div class="breadcrumbs" typeof="BreadcrumbList" vocab="https://schema.org/">';
    bcn_display();
    echo '</div>';
}
?>

最后,关注移动端体验。Google 已经全面转向移动优先索引,因此你的主题必须是响应式的。使用 Google 的 Mobile-Friendly Test 工具检查页面,确保字体大小、按钮间距和图片适配都达到标准。同时,利用 Schema 结构化数据标记文章类型(如文章、产品、FAQ),这能让你的内容在搜索结果中展示更丰富的摘要,提升点击率。

总结

通过本文的 WordPress 教程,我们从性能优化、安全加固、开发效率到内容策略,全面梳理了实战中的关键点。记住,一个成功的 WordPress 站点不是一蹴而就的,它需要持续的关注与迭代。建议你从最基础的缓存和备份开始,逐步应用安全规则,再根据业务需求定制功能。避免一次性进行大量改动,每次调整后都要测试效果。希望这些最佳实践能帮助你在使用 WordPress 的过程中少走弯路,打造出既快又稳、且内容丰富的网站。 作者:大佬虾 | 专注实用技术教程

正文结束 阅读本文相关话题
相关阅读
评论框
正在回复
评论列表
暂无评论,快来抢沙发吧~
sitemap